Alzheimer’s disease profoundly alters how individuals perceive and interpret silence, transforming what might be a neutral or even comforting experience into something complex, unsettling, or confusing. This change is rooted in the way Alzheimer’s disrupts brain functions related to memory, sensory processing, emotional regulation, and communication.
Silence, in everyday life, is often a backdrop against which sounds, conversations, and activities occur. For most people, silence can be peaceful, a moment to rest or reflect. However, in Alzheimer’s, the brain’s ability to process and make sense of silence shifts dramatically. This is because Alzheimer’s primarily damages areas of the brain responsible for interpreting sensory input, managing emotional responses, and understanding context. As the disease progresses, these impairments mean that silence is no longer just the absence of sound but can become a source of anxiety, confusion, or even fear.
One key reason Alzheimer’s changes the interpretation of silence is the loss of memory and cognitive function. When a person with Alzheimer’s hears silence, they may struggle to recall what silence means or what should come next. The brain’s impaired ability to predict or anticipate events makes silence feel unpredictable or threatening. For example, in normal cognition, silence might signal a pause before a familiar sound or conversation resumes. But for someone with Alzheimer’s, this expectation is lost, and silence can feel like an empty void, triggering feelings of loneliness or abandonment.
Moreover, Alzheimer’s affects language and communication centers in the brain, which complicates how silence is understood. People with Alzheimer’s often experience difficulty in expressing themselves and interpreting others’ intentions. Silence in conversation, which might normally indicate thoughtfulness or a natural pause, can be misread as disinterest, hostility, or confusion. This misinterpretation can lead to frustration or agitation, both for the person with Alzheimer’s and their caregivers.
Emotional processing is also disrupted in Alzheimer’s, altering how silence is emotionally experienced. The disease can heighten anxiety and restlessness, especially in quiet environments. Silence can amplify these feelings because there are no external sounds to distract or soothe. Without familiar auditory cues, the brain may fill the silence with imagined noises or fears, sometimes leading to hallucinations or paranoia. This is why some individuals with Alzheimer’s may become agitated or distressed in silent settings, seeking noise or activity to feel grounded.
The sensory processing changes caused by Alzheimer’s further complicate the experience of silence. The brain’s filtering of sensory information becomes less efficient, so the absence of sound might paradoxically feel overwhelming or disorienting. Instead of silence being a blank slate, it becomes a confusing sensory state where the brain struggles to find meaning or context. This can lead to behaviors such as repetitive vocalizations or restlessness as the person attempts to break the silence and regain a sense of control.
Interestingly, the use of sound and music therapy in Alzheimer’s care highlights how important auditory stimulation is for these patients. Music and familiar sounds can reduce agitation and improve mood, suggesting that silence, when prolonged or unstructured, may contribute to negative emotional states. This therapeutic approach underscores that silence is not simply neutral but interacts deeply with the altered brain functions in Alzheimer’s.
In the middle and later stages of Alzheimer’s, when cognitive decline is more severe, the interpretation of silence becomes even more altered. The person may no longer recognize familiar voices or environmental sounds, making silence feel like a complete sensory and social isolation. This can exacerbate confusion and fear, sometimes leading to withdrawal or aggressive behaviors. The brain’s diminished capacity to organize thoughts and memories means silence is not a restful pause but a disorienting blankness.
Overall, Alzheimer’s changes how silence is interpreted by disrupting the brain’s memory, language, emotional, and sensory systems. Silence ceases to be a simple absence of noise and instead becomes a complex experience that can evoke anxiety, confusion, or distress.
